Here I am. Saturday night after a little test at Lake Ontario.

Tomorrow is supposed to be a big day.

Tomorrow the whole crew supposed to be at Lake Ontario for the swim Trial.

16 Km. or 6 hours whatever happens first.

I was very confident until the wind started to blow a few days ago and took away the warmer water.

Two days ago the water temp. at the lake was 8 Celsius. Yesterday went up a few degrees anything close to something comfortable.

A few hours ago I went down to Hamilton where this swim supposed to happen tomorrow.

The water was not above 13 degrees.

Again, I had this burning from inside out feeling that lasted for at least 15 minutes. I couldn't pee even when I really wanted and I got alarmed. Finally I stopped, change my breathing rhythm then peed and kept going.

Wasn't pretty but came back home mentally prepared for tomorrow.

However in this conditions you do not need much to hesitate. An experienced Swim Master Marilyn Korzekwa (two succesful crossings under her belt) said that she would be seriously considering next week because the winds tonight only are going to get worst and take the bit of warm water away…

looks like less than 12 hours to the start I still do not know what is going to happen… but I'll keep you posted
